What to Eat
There are many great places to eat in Abucay and Santa Rosa. Some of the popular dishes include:
- Adobo: A traditional Filipino dish made with pork or chicken stewed in soy sauce, vinegar, garlic, and bay leaves.
- Kare-kare: A peanut-based stew made with oxtail, vegetables, and shrimp paste.
- Sinigang: A sour soup made with pork, vegetables, and tamarind.
- Lumpia: A spring roll filled with meat, vegetables, and noodles.
Where to Go
There are many things to see and do in Abucay and Santa Rosa. Some of the popular attractions include:
- Mount Samat: A historical landmark that offers stunning views of Bataan.
- Las Casas Filipinas de Acuzar: A heritage park that showcases traditional Filipino architecture.
- Bataan National Park: A protected area that is home to a variety of flora and fauna.
- Subic Bay: A former US naval base that is now a popular tourist destination.
